Blast off to Misadventure!

Step into the whimsical world of Lancelot Biggs, the endearing and often bumbling hero of a beloved series by Nelson S. Bond. Known for its delightful blend of science fiction, humor, and the absurd, this collection compiles all the stories of Biggs, a man with grand aspirations and even grander mishaps.

Lancelot Biggs, an everyman caught between the ordinary and the extraordinary, is a recurring character who finds himself embroiled in outlandish situations-whether he's unintentionally saving the world, stumbling into intergalactic adventure, or solving seemingly impossible problems in his own peculiar way. Bond's sharp wit, clever dialogue, and ability to infuse both charm and chaos into every page make these tales both timeless and endlessly entertaining.

Originally published in the golden age of speculative fiction, these stories are laced with the optimism of mid-20th-century science fiction, yet retain a refreshing, timeless quality that still resonates with readers today. Whether exploring alien worlds or getting caught in the machinations of eccentric inventors, Lancelot Biggs is always ready for his next adventure-whether he's prepared or not!
